1st Logo (5 September 2005-30 April, 2010, 2018)

Visuals: On a table with paper and crayons scattered around, we see a large box with orange and blue sides. It opens up and the camera zooms in to reveal a pop-up scene with two paper cut-out animals, one orange adult and one blue child. Eventually, they come together in the middle of the screen, with "NICK" fading in on the orange animal, and "JR" fading in on the blue animal in the Nickelodeon corporate font of the era.

Variants:

  • Frogs: Set in a pond with lilypads and reeds, a small blue frog hops into frame and croaks. It hops across more lilypads onto a much larger one, where an orange frog is sat. The blue frog hops next to it, and they both begin to croak as the "NICK JR" text fades in.
  • Cats: In a typical living room with a TV, an orange cat is sitting on a couch. It jumps onto the floor and sniffs at a food bowl, before a red yarn ball bounces into view in the background. The ball bounces around, leaving a trail of red string across the room. Eventually, a smaller blue cat is revealed from the yarn ball, coming to a stop next to the orange cat. The two nuzzle each other and open their mouths as the "NICK JR" text fades in. A short version of this ident was used as the overnight loop (see Availability).
  • Crocodiles: A box opens up to a jungle. An orange and blue crocodile pop up the water and then come out and then "NICK JR" text fades in as they nuzzle.
  • Elephants: An orange elephant is in the water and a blue elephant calf comes. then, the text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Butterflies: A box opens up to bushes, an orange and blue butterfly are seen. As they fly, flowers bloom. When they get to the bush, the "NICK JR" text fades in.
  • Fish: In a fishbowl, an orange fish and blue fish are seen swimming. The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Owls: On a tree an orange and blue owl with "NICK JR" come together. As it zooms out, various animals are seen as the box closes.
  • Octopi: The box opens to an ocean. An orange octopus with a blue octopus are seen. The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Foxes: A box opens to a night background. An orange fox with a blue fox are hiding. When they find each other, "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Penguins: The box opens in the snow. An orange penguin slides and the blue penguin chick jumps. Then, they slide and the text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Pigs In a pen, orange pig and a blue piglet are seen. The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Squirrels: As the box opens, an orange and blue squirrels are seen on climbing on a tree and the text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Goats: Set in a snowy mountain, an orange goat and blue goat are seen jumping. The text "NICK JR" fades in, as they go to the top.
  • Rabbits: The box opens up to a garden where an orange grabbit and blue rabbit come out. The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Dogs: As a box opens, we see a blue puppy and orange dog. The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Ladybugs: A box opens up to bushes, an orange and blue ladybugs are seen. The text "NICK JR" fades in, but then fades out as they fly.
  • Monkeys: As a box opens, we see a blue monkey and orange monkey in a jungle. They swing to get bananas, and then the text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Toucans: As a box opens, we see a blue toucan and orange toucan in a jungle The text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Lions: The box opens to a night background where an a orange lion and blue lion cub are seen. The two lions roar, and then the text "NICK JR" fades in.
  • Crabs: On a beach, an orange crab with a blue crab are seen walking to the ocean. the text "NICK JR" fades in.

Technique: CGI created at Studio AKA. Directed by Mic Graves, animated using Softimage XSI.[1]

Audio: The sound of chimes can be heard when the box opens, and as the camera zooms in a jingle (which was Nick Jr.'s "Love to play!" jingle from 2004 to 2007) featuring various percussive instruments such as a xylophone and bongos can be heard.

Audio Variants: In the Christmas idents, an orchestral rendition of "We Wish You A Merry Christmas" is heard instead.

Availability: No longer in use. These idents were seen on the UK channel for five years, the Cats ident being the last one broadcasted in the early hours of 30 April 2010 due to its usage as a overnight loop.[2] Some of the idents were retained in on-demand prints of Nick Jr. shows until 2018, and various other idents are only available in partial form and are considered to be lost media.
